In the report submitted here, an elementary formula is presented that allows calculation of the fine structure constant, derived on the basis of the unified theory of the electromagnetic and gravitational field elaborated by the author. This theory is based on the laws of relativity and quantum mechanics, in a brand new insight into the interpretation of gravitational forces. The electron model designed by the author then offers a remarkable reply to the problem of the electric charge essence. A direct implication of this theory is the functional dependence of the charge upon the Planck constant and the speed of light, therefore the fine structure constant can be identified with arbitrary numerical accuracy. There is no visible difference between the presented value of this constant and the experimental result stemming from the area related in a way to this theory, the quantum Hall effect.
